How much do manufacturing engineering manager jobs pay per year?

As of Sep 5, 2026, the average yearly pay for manufacturing engineering manager in Manchester, NH is $120,043.00, according to ZipRecruiter salary data. Most workers in this role earn between $107,300.00 and $133,100.00 per year, depending on experience, location, and employer.

What does a manufacturing engineering manager do?

A Manufacturing Engineering Manager leads teams of engineers to improve manufacturing processes, enhance production efficiency, and ensure product quality. They plan and oversee projects related to process optimization, equipment upgrades, and new product introductions. Their role also involves collaborating with other departments, managing budgets, and ensuring compliance with safety and regulatory standards. Ultimately, they play a key part in driving operational excellence and supporting the company's production goals.

What does a manufacturing engineering manager do?

A manufacturing engineering manager is responsible for the overall function of the manufacturing processes for a company. In this role, you evaluate and implement strategies that improve productivity and lower costs. Your job duties include approving product design changes, managing budgets, overseeing development projects, approving equipment upgrades, and interacting with upper management. The qualifications needed for a career as a manufacturing engineering manager include a bachelor’s degree in an engineering field and several years of experience in manufacturing. There are professional certifications available to demonstrate your skills.

How does a manufacturing engineering manager typically collaborate with cross-functional teams to drive process improvements?

Manufacturing Engineering Managers work closely with teams such as production, quality assurance, supply chain, and product design to identify opportunities for process optimization. They often lead or participate in cross-functional meetings to align on project goals, troubleshoot production issues, and implement new technologies or methodologies. Effective communication and project management skills are essential, as they must ensure that improvements meet both engineering standards and production needs while staying within budget and timeline constraints. Collaboration is key to fostering innovation and maintaining efficient manufacturing operations.

What are the key skills and qualifications needed to thrive as a manufacturing engineering manager, and why are they important?

To thrive as a Manufacturing Engineering Manager, you need a strong background in engineering principles, process optimization, and project management, typically supported by a bachelor's degree in engineering and relevant experience. Familiarity with CAD software, ERP systems, Lean manufacturing methodologies, and certifications such as Six Sigma are commonly required. Leadership, problem-solving, and effective communication are critical soft skills for managing teams and cross-functional projects. These skills ensure efficient production processes, continuous improvement, and successful team performance in a competitive manufacturing environment.

What is the difference between Manufacturing Engineering Manager vs Manufacturing Engineer?

AspectManufacturing Engineering ManagerManufacturing Engineer
CredentialsBachelor's degree in engineering, often with management experienceBachelor's or higher in engineering or related field
Work EnvironmentOversees teams in manufacturing plants, manages projectsDesigns and improves manufacturing processes, works on the shop floor or in design
Industry UsageCommonly in manufacturing companies, overseeing production processesInvolved in process development, quality, and production support

The Manufacturing Engineering Manager focuses on leading teams and managing manufacturing projects, while the Manufacturing Engineer concentrates on designing and optimizing manufacturing processes. Both roles require engineering credentials and are integral to production operations, but the manager has a broader leadership and oversight responsibility.

GENERAL SUMMARY:

The Quality Engineering Manager is responsible for providing strategic and operational leadership for the Quality Engineering, Calibration, and Inspection functions across multiple manufacturing sites that produce both medical device components and finished medical devices. This role serves as a key partner to operations, manufacturing engineering, supply chain, and regulatory/quality systems leadership to improve product quality, reduce Cost of Poor Quality (COPQ), drive process capability, and ensure compliance with applicable regulatory and quality system requirements.

The Quality Engineering Manager leads a team of quality engineers, calibration specialists, inspectors, and quality team leads, ensuring effective support of manufacturing operations through risk-based decision making, statistical analysis, root cause investigations, and continuous improvement initiatives. The manager establishes a culture of quality ownership, operational excellence, and customer focus while ensuring compliance with ISO 13485, FDA Quality System Regulation, and other applicable regulatory requirements.

This position is expected to actively engage with manufacturing operations to identify process risks, reduce scrap and rework, improve yield, and eliminate recurring quality issues through structured problem-solving and data-driven decision making.
